* Online multiplayer is built in. * A wide-screen option is available, the game play will still be in a 4:3 field, but the viewable area will be wide-screen. * It’s based on the Dreamcast version. * The new MvC2 will use the same net code that powered SSF2T HD Remix. * Leaderboards and some stat tracking will be available. * There will be a quarter mode and lobby system for online players. * Two HD Upscaling options. "Smooth" and "Crisp" that render on the fly. You can also go with the "Classic" non-upscaled look. * No unlocking. All 56 characters will be available from the start. * Music can be changed out with your own custom tracks or you can adjust the volume levels. * The game was developed by Backbone. * You will be taken for a ride.
